- Samsung soon allows you to select Swipe Navigation as default when setting a new phone.
- Samsung is testing an election screen that will allow the selection between the 3 button navigation and swipe navigation signals during the setup.
- This feature is only being tested and can be introduced with an UI 8.5 on the Galaxy S26.

Although Google and other Android manufacturers have accepted swipe navigation indicators, when you compile a new Samsung phone, the Three button system is pre -selected. If someone wants to use navigation gestures, they must go towards their galaxy phones or tablets settings and will have to change it manually after completing the setup. However, with the future version of an UI 8, Samsung can eventually allow users to choose between the three buttons and indicator navigation systems while setting their phone.
